| Petersons Connoisseur's Choice in a XL Basket weave meer.I like to smoke the aromatics in Meerschaum rather than my briars.This is a tasty blend;A satisfying,spicy and aromatic blend of Black Cavendish,Golden and Red Virginias,mixed with luxury broken flake.The aromatic recipe of Tropical fruit,Maple,Vanilla&Rum,make this blend smooth and very pleasant.Try it,you'll like it!
